CABO (www.carolinaalpacaframs.org)

 

 is very excited over the success of

 

the 2010- "Carolina Alpaca Celebration"

 

held February 13-14, 2009

 

at the Cabarrus Arena and Events Center in

 

 Concord, NC (near Charlotte, NC).

 

 

In spite of all the snow in the midwest and the east coast, there were over 140 farms brought their best to the show and had a great time.

The Alpaca Fiber Symposium

Was held April 4-5, 2009

at Gaston Textile College

Belmont, NC (near Charlotte)

 

with a followup symposium held in Denver, CO

Sept 23-25, 2009.

 

Theme:

 

Alpaca Fiber -

Today, Tomorrow, and Beyond

 

Perfect for both current and prospective owners of alpacas.  Presenters and Speakers for this symposium are committed to promoting alpaca fiber and shared information on current fiber uses as well as exploring new horizons for alpaca fiber.
